Transaction 342275108f23e55c7318a9c6f9594447c09f7a94d2223df52a1451666b18ab08

1 Input
2 Outputs
  • 342275108f23e55c7318a9c6f9594447c09f7a94d2223df52a1451666b18ab08:0
  • value  69978646
    address  134JE6Zerdd2T418QAAmeK6Q5FJ4FR2XSe
  • 342275108f23e55c7318a9c6f9594447c09f7a94d2223df52a1451666b18ab08:1
  • value  1160000
    address  1Adb2T2jLh4Zgzsf9MGkpDC2muVakQx7DP